Lists it IT - Reetus/ClassicAssist GitHub Wiki

Lista Comandi per gli Script di ClassicAssist

Generato il 15/12/2024 03:30:41
Versione: 4.425.22+b9a337759d26b9d39ae8ccaac75a36c4255be94a
Tradotto da riin4

Liste

ClearList

Sintassi del comando:

Void ClearList(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Pulisci la lista desiderata

Esempio:

ClearList("list")  

CreateList

Sintassi del comando:

Void CreateList(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Crea una lista. Se già esiste, viene sovrascritta

Esempio:

CreateList("list")  

GetList

Sintassi del comando:

System.Object[] GetList(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Riporta la matrice di tutte le voci di una lista, da utilizzare con For, Loop, etc.

Esempio:

GetList("list")  

InList

Sintassi del comando:

Boolean InList(System.String, System.Object)

Parametri

  • listname: Nome Lista.
  • value: Valore intero: vedere la descrizione per l'utilizzo.

Descrizione:

Controlla se in una lista è presente un dato elemento

Esempio:

if InList("shmoo", 1):  

List

Sintassi del comando:

Int32 List(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Riporta il numero degli elementi presenti in una lista

Esempio:

if List("list") < 5:  

ListExists

Sintassi del comando:

Boolean ListExists(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Riporta se una lista esiste

Esempio:

if ListExists("list"):  

PopList

Sintassi del comando:

Int32 PopList(System.String, System.Object)

Parametri

  • listname: Nome Lista.
  • elementvalue: Valore Elemento da rimuovere dalla lista, oppure 'front' per rimuovere il primo oggetto della lista, oppure 'back' per rimuovere l'ultimo. (default: 'back') (Opzionale). (Opzionale)

Descrizione:

Rimuove elementi da una lista e riporta il numero di elementi rimossi

Esempio:

CreateList("hippies")
PushList("hippies", 1)
PushList("hippies", 2)
PushList("hippies", 3)

PopList("hippies", "front") # Removes 1
PopList("hippies", "back") # Removes 3
PopList("hippies", "2") # Removes any 2's that exist in the list


for x in GetList("hippies"):
 print x # Never reached because list is empty
  

PushList

Sintassi del comando:

Void PushList(System.String, System.Object)

Parametri

  • listname: Nome Lista.
  • value: Valore intero: vedere la descrizione per l'utilizzo.

Descrizione:

Inserisce un valore alla fine di una lista, crea la lista se non esiste

Esempio:

PushList("list", 1)  

RemoveList

Sintassi del comando:

Void RemoveList(System.String)

Parametri

  • listname: Nome Lista.

Descrizione:

Rimuove la lista desiderata

Esempio:

RemoveList("list")